The Hotel Group adds two Seattle hotels

The Hotel Group, a national hotel management, investment and development company and affiliate of Hotel Equities, has grown its Pacific Northwest hotel management portfolio with the addition of two Hyatt-branded hotels in downtown Seattle, Hyatt House Seattle Downtown Hotel and Hyatt Place Seattle Downtown Hotel.

The Hyatt House Seattle Downtown Hotel is located across the street from the Seattle Center, home of the Space Needle, Climate Pledge Arena, the Museum of Pop Culture and several other Seattle attractions. It offers seating areas and in-room kitchen amenities, as well as rooftop open-air space. Additional amenities include complimentary daily hot breakfast, a fitness center, a business center, H market and H Bar.

The Hyatt Place Seattle Downtown Hotel, located three blocks from the Seattle Center, features a complimentary breakfast bar, an indoor swimming pool, a fitness center, a boardroom and meeting space. Guestrooms include a seating area with a 42-in., flat-screen TV, refrigerator and sofa bed.

The hotels have a combined key count of 332 guestrooms.
